Fee options

Fixed

Flat fees generally range from $500 to $25,000 per agreement for financial planning, consulting, and business exit consulting.

Percentage

$0 - $499,999.99: 2.05% (Park Avenue Portfolio Select SM Program maximum client fee) $500,000 - $999,999.99: 2.00% (Park Avenue Portfolio Select SM Program maximum client fee) $1,000,000 - $1,999,999.99: 1.95% (Park Avenue Portfolio Select SM Program maximum client fee) $2,000,000+: 1.90% (Park Avenue Portfolio Select SM Program maximum client fee)

Commissions

Brokerage commission fees apply in transaction-based accounts; ticket charges $10 per transaction in Portfolio Select SM program; commissions on securities transactions; fees vary widely depending on products.

Project-based

Hourly financial planning or consulting fees generally range from $100 to $500 per hour.

Subscriptions

Subscription-Based Financial Planning up to $25,000 per year; Subscription-Based Business Financial Consulting up to $30,000 annually; fees paid monthly or quarterly.

Other

Account minimum: $5,000 for VestWise digital advisory program; generally $10,000 minimum initial investment for most other Proprietary Programs, with some individual Strategist or Investment Manager minimums higher or variable (e.g., Portfolio Select SM and Signature Portfolio SM require $10,000; UMA Select SM requires $10,000 but can be higher). Minimum fee: Annual platform fee minimum of $90 per household for Park Avenue Proprietary Programs other than VestWise. Fee-only: Financial planning or consulting fees are negotiable; hourly fees typically $100-$500 per hour; flat fees generally $500 to $25,000; subscription-based financial planning up to $25,000 annually; business consulting up to $30,000 per engagement or annually.

Hi, I'm Dave Rowan. As the President and Founder of Rowan Financial, my primary responsibility is to provide my clients with the tools and encouragement they need to achieve their most important goals. With over 16 years of experience in the financial services industry, I specialize in assisting real estate investors, pre-retirees and new families in growing their wealth, and bettering their own lives along with the lives of their family and community. Before founding Rowan Financial in 2011, I spent 24 years at Crayola, where I most recently served as the Director of Research & Development. Over the course of my career, I have obtained the C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ER™ (CFP®) designation and the Series 65 Advisor Law Certification. I hold a Bachelor of Science in Chemical Engineering from Penn State, obtained in 1992, and an MBA from Lehigh University, earned in 2000. I am also a member of the National Association of Personal Financial Planners (NAPFA) and the XY Planning Network, which affords me the opportunity to participate in multiple masterminds and study groups to learn from others and continue to enhance my skills as an advisor. I get to know each of my clients personally and understand what really matters to them beyond the numbers on their account statements. Should we work together, you will know what is possible for you in your life, and you will receive a prioritized Financial Action Plan along with the encouragement you need. I am especially passionate about helping people navigate big transitions in their lives, whether that be leaving your corporate job for full time entrepreneurship, buying your first investment property or starting a new family. I have personal experience in each of these areas and bring that technical expertise to bear should we work together. I also recognize that, like me, you’re a human being dealing with all of the emotions and concerns that these changes can bring up. When we talk about your finances, we’ll always talk about the “math” as well as the “quality of life” implications of each decision and make the call that’s best for you and those you love.
